Dhaka, June 24 -- Google's digital service platform Google Wallet-commonly known as "Google Pay"-has been officially launched in Bangladesh for the first time.
The service is being introduced in partnership with tech giant Google by City Bank, a leading institution in the country's private sector.
Bangladesh Bank Governor Ahsan H Mansur inaugurated the service at The Westin Hotel in Dhaka's Gulshan on Tuesday,
The City Bank launched the digital payment service in collaboration with Google, Mastercard, and Visa.
